Are you done?


OK. So there are 11 days til Cmas. Are you done?

Here are some last minute thoughts from cousin Nancy
to keep us on task...

  • Check your lists, what do you have left?, what can wait?, is it important or not?
  • No list? MAKE ONE!--be realistic and prioritize. Break everything down into manageable tasks--you can get things done without going crazy.
  • Make time for your family and yourself!
Wow. This year has flown. Thanks, cousin Nancy.

The only thing I add to the above is keep your list with you and mark off as you go. This gives me a sense of accomplishment. By the end of the day, my list is all rumpled up and marked on, and shows I've done something!
